What Is Financing?

Financing is the process of providing funds for business activities, making purchases, or investing. It is the act of securing the capital necessary to achieve certain goals, whether personal or organizational. For CA students, understanding financing is crucial as it forms the backbone of financial management and decision-making. There are various sources from which financing can be obtained, including personal savings, loans, or investments from external sources. The primary objective of financing is to ensure that the necessary resources are available to carry out projects, sustain operations, or make significant purchases without compromising the financial stability of the individual or the organization. Types of Financing

Understanding the various Types of Financing is crucial for making informed financial decisions. Each type offers unique benefits and challenges, catering to different needs and financial situations. Let’s delve into the most common Types of Financing and explore how they can be utilized effectively.

1. Debt Financing

Debt financing involves borrowing money that must be repaid with interest over a specified period. This type of financing is common for both businesses and individuals. The lender does not gain ownership in the entity, and the borrower retains full control of the asset or business. The primary advantage of debt financing is that the interest payments are often tax-deductible, which can reduce the overall cost of borrowing. However, the obligation to repay the debt with interest can strain cash flow, especially if the borrowed amount is significant.

2. Equity Financing

Equity financing involves raising capital by selling shares of a company to investors. Unlike debt financing, there is no obligation to repay the funds or pay interest. Instead, investors receive ownership stakes in the company and share in its profits. The main benefit of equity financing is that it does not create debt, and investors often bring additional expertise and resources to the business. However, equity financing dilutes ownership and may lead to loss of control over certain business decisions.

3. Hybrid Financing

Hybrid financing combines elements of both debt and equity financing. Instruments such as convertible bonds and preference shares are examples of hybrid financing. Convertible bonds, for instance, start as debt but can be converted into equity at a later date. Hybrid financing offers flexibility and can be tailored to meet specific financial needs. It allows companies to benefit from the advantages of both debt and equity, although it may also involve more complex terms and conditions.

4. Trade Credit

Trade credit is a short-term financing option where suppliers allow businesses to purchase goods or services on credit, with payment due at a later date. This type of financing helps businesses manage cash flow by deferring payment without incurring interest costs. Trade credit is commonly used in industries where maintaining inventory is crucial. However, relying too heavily on trade credit can strain supplier relationships if payments are delayed.

5. Lease Financing

Lease financing involves renting an asset, such as equipment or property, for a specific period. Instead of purchasing the asset outright, businesses can lease it, preserving capital for other uses. Lease payments are typically lower than loan payments, and leases may offer tax benefits. However, at the end of the lease term, the business does not own the asset, and there may be additional costs if the lease is extended or renewed. Types of Financing FAQs

What is debt financing?

Debt financing involves borrowing money that must be repaid with interest over time, typically through loans or bonds.

How does equity financing work?

Equity financing raises capital by selling ownership shares of a company, giving investors a stake in the business without the obligation of repayment.

What is hybrid financing?

Hybrid financing combines features of both debt and equity, offering flexible financial instruments like convertible bonds.

Why is trade credit important?

Trade credit allows businesses to purchase goods on credit, improving cash flow without immediate payment, although it requires careful management to avoid supplier conflicts.

What are the benefits of lease financing?

Lease financing preserves capital by allowing businesses to use assets without purchasing them, often with lower payments and potential tax advantages.
